You waited 20 years for this! Glad you're back The wear in front of the forward assist, I assume is on the shell deflector, the wedge behind the ejection port. Most of the brass marks should wipe off with solvent. Then again, they're just proof that you actually use your rifle. keep shootin, and get a reloading setup, it's worth the money and a lot of fun too. |
